alaTest has collected and analyzed 54 reviews of Nothing Ear (1). The average rating for this product is 4.0/5, compared to an average rating of 4.0/5 for other Headphones for all reviews. Opinions about the noise isolation and comfort are overall positive. The price and design also get good opinions. Some have doubts about the mids quality.

sound, design, price, comfort, noise isolation

mids quality

We analyzed user and expert ratings, product age and more factors. Compared to other Headphones the Nothing Ear (1) is awarded an overall alaScore™ of 94/100 = Excellent quality.

Expert review by : What Hi-Fi? (whathifi.com)

Nothing Ear (1) review

 

Are Nothing's inaugural earbuds actually quite... something?

Extensive feature set ; Enjoyable app ; Strong aesthetic

Tubby bass ; Timing issues ; Over-emphasised upper midrange

Nothing ventured, nothing gained: Nothing Ear (1) has the specifications to become a budget headphone contender, but the sound is a good step below class-leading

Expert review by : Dominic Preston (techadvisor.co.uk)

Nothing Ear (1) review

 

The Nothing Ear (1) are the first headphones from Carl Pei's new brand, and are a great option for ANC and wireless charging on a budget

Active noise cancellation ; Wireless charging ; Affordable price point

Average audio quality ; Divisive design ; Slightly buggy

On paper, the Ear (1) outpace almost all the competition at the price point simply by virtue of including premium features like ANC and wireless charging. In practice, the good-but-not-great audio quality and battery life hold these back a little, as...
